Terengganu is one of the eastern states located Peninsular Malaysia. Here is where you will find some of the most beautiful and luxurious beaches and islands in the world. The state offers a wide array of choices for tourists who come here each day to either enjoy the seaside attractions, diving at the nearby islands, indulging in the islands or for its natural surroundings which are shared with neighboring states Pahang and Johor.
Beautiful beaches and sensational greens
The state is home to some of the most naturally rich beach sides while it is also very much popular for its cultural attractions. Terengganu is home to the beaches that bring the endangered species like the Leatherback turtles who come and lay their eggs during their respective seasons. You will find that the state is encircled with some very rich and thick rainforests and many lush Golf Courses as well.
Golfing in Terengganu
The main city here is Kuala Terengganu, which is the state capital while there is also an international golf course located in other towns like Kemaman and Dungun as well. In Kemaman, you will be able to enjoy a game at the Awana Kijal Beach and Golf Resort. This course is considered to be one of the most reputable and established Golf Courses in Malaysia. It was designed by a local named Mohd Kamel Yassin and comes with an 18 hole stretch in its 6,500-meter land size. The Ibai Golf and Country Club is located not far from the capital that comes with an 18 hole green designed by Andy Dye. You can also head out towards the very prestigious Kuala Terengganu Golf Resort located not far from here.
Over in Dungun, you will find that Kelab Golf Desa Dungun offers an 18 hole stretch. Also located not far from here is the 18-hole Tasik Puteri Golf & Country Club. Over in Tasik Kenyir is the Tasik Kenyir Golf Resort that comes with a 9 hole Ross Watson designed green. One of the latest additions for golfers around here is the Rantau Petronas Country Club which is known to offer one of the biggest bunkers among all other courses in Malaysia. The green here was designed by Ronald Fream and is located in Kerteh, which is quite isolated from the major cities and towns of the state, making it an ideal place to enjoy your game.
